All-Season Tires vs. Chains: Which Option Is Better for Central Oregon Drivers?
Winter in Central Oregon has a way of turning roads into shifting puzzles — sometimes tame and dry, other times crusted with icy surprises. Choosing the right traction strategy isn’t just about comfort; it’s a key part of safe driving and smart Central Oregon car insurance planning. Two of the most common options are all-season tires and tire chains, but each plays a very different role once the snow starts swirling. All-Season Tires: The Everyday Workhorse All-season tires are designed to handle a spectrum of conditions, from warm pavement to light snow. Tips to Prevent Distracted Driving: Stay Safe Behind the Wheel
Distracted driving is a significant contributor to the numerous accidents on American roads. According to the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A), thousands lose their lives each year because drivers lose focus. Whether it’s texting, adjusting the radio, or eating, just a few seconds of distraction can have serious consequences. Fortunately, every driver can take proactive steps to stay alert. Here are tips to help prevent distracted driving. How To Prevent Distracted Driving Cell phones are one of the biggest culprits of distracted driving. 5 Ways to Lower Your Car Insurance Premium in Bend, Oregon
Car insurance premiums can be a significant expense, but there are several ways to reduce the cost, especially for residents in a city like Bend, Oregon. From adjusting your coverage to taking advantage of discounts, here are five effective strategies to lower your car insurance premium: Bundle Insurance Policies One of the most straightforward ways to lower your car insurance premium is to bundle your auto insurance with other policies, such as homeowners or renters insurance. Many insurance companies offer discounts when you purchase multiple types of insurance through them.
